What Does Tom Izzo Need to Do to Get to the Final Four in Detroit in 2027?

Summary

Tom Izzo, the longtime coach of the Michigan State Spartans basketball team, aims to lead his team to the Final Four in Detroit in 2027. To achieve this, key players like Jeremy Fears Jr. need to stay, new recruits must develop quickly, and new players like Anton Bonke should be added to the team’s playing rotation.

Key Facts

  • Tom Izzo has coached the Michigan State Spartans since 1995 and is 71 years old.
  • The Final Four basketball tournament will be held in Detroit at Ford Field in 2027.
  • Jeremy Fears Jr., the team’s star point guard, is crucial for Michigan State’s success and may stay for another season.
  • Player transfers are common, so Izzo needs to quickly train new recruits like Jasiah Jervis.
  • Anton Bonke, a 7-foot-2 transfer center, recently joined the team and fits well with the Spartans.
  • Izzo’s coaching reputation comes from many years of experience and respect in college basketball.
  • Keeping strong players and quickly using new talent is important for building a competitive team.
